Job Description • Plan, organize, and supervise daily catering / restaurant operations to ensure efficient service and compliance with client and company standards. • Coordinate with the Chief Cook and kitchen team to ensure the timely availability and replenishment of food and beverages during service. • Supervise restaurant staff, prepare duty rosters, allocate responsibilities, and monitor attendance to maintain optimal staffing levels. • Train, coach, and motivate team members to deliver excellent customer service and maintain high performance standards. • Ensure the restaurant is fully prepared for service, including proper setup of counters, equipment, and dining areas. • Monitor inventory, prepare daily requisitions, inspect incoming supplies, and ensure proper storage, stock rotation, and wastage control. • Handle customer inquiries and complaints professionally, ensuring prompt resolution while maintaining high customer satisfaction. • Ensure all restaurant equipment is operational, report maintenance issues promptly, and maintain a clean, organized, and hygienic work environment. • Enforce compliance with Quality, Health, Safety, and Environment (QHSE) policies, including food safety, personal hygiene, PPE usage, pest control, and staff safety training. • Monitor operational costs, food quality, and service standards to achieve business objectives while implementing company policies and performing other duties assigned by management Job Requirements • Diploma or Bachelor's degree in Hospitality Management, Hotel Management, Food & Beverage Management, or a related field. • Minimum 3–5 years of experience in restaurant or catering operations, including at least 1–2 years in a supervisory role. • Strong knowledge of restaurant operations, food service standards, inventory management, and customer service best practices. • Proven leadership and team management skills with the ability to train, motivate, and supervise multicultural teams. • Good understanding of food safety, hygiene, sanitation, HACCP, and QHSE standards. • Experience in preparing staff schedules, managing manpower, controlling overtime, and coordinating daily operational requirements. • Strong organ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ills with the ability to handle customer complaints professionally. • Proficiency in inventory control, stock rotation, requisition planning, and cost and wastage management. • Ability to work under pressure in a fast-paced environment while maintaining high standards of service quality and operational efficiency. • Willingness to work flexible shifts, weekends, and public holidays, with a commitment to continuous learning and adherence to company policies and client requirements.
